¿Qué son los servicios de fabricación electrónica (EMS)?

Los servicios relacionados con la fabricación electrónica a veces se denominan servicios de fabricación e incluyen servicios de ensamblaje de PCB proporcionados por empresas que fabrican productos electrónicos en nombre de otra empresa. Por ejemplo, cuando una marca diseña un producto, no fabrica el producto en sí, sino que se asocia con EMS. Típicamente, un EMS completo incluye los siguientes servicios:

  • Ensamblador inicial de PCB (PCBA): montaje y soldadura de piezas en circuitos y placas, incluyendo tecnologías SMD, THT y mixtas.
  • Ensamblaje de caja / sistema: añadir el PCBA terminado con todas las piezas necesarias, como conectores y cables.
  • Servicios de diseño: diseño para fabricación (DfM), diseño para pruebas (DfT), diseño para costos y diseño para compras.
  • Pruebas: ICT (Prueba en circuito), prueba con sonda voladora, prueba funcional, prueba de escaneo de frontera y prueba de burn-in.
  • Cadena de suministro: desde la adquisición de componentes y compra de bienes hasta la gestión de inventarios y la disposición de stock que ya no se utiliza.
  • Servicios de soporte en la parte posterior: reparación, reacondicionamiento y devoluciones desde el campo.
  • Logística: almacenamiento, embalaje y envío.

Existe un diferenciador clave entre las empresas EMS y las empresas ODM: mientras que un ODM produce un producto utilizando su propia propiedad intelectual, un EMS desarrolla únicamente su diseño. ¿Por qué Francia? Las fortalezas de los EMS franceses

Los compradores eligen proveedores EMS franceses por varias razones concretas:

Fortaleza Lo que significa para usted
Excelencia en alta variedad / volumen medio Las empresas EMS francesas se especializan en productos complejos y de menor volumen — ideales para electrónica industrial, médica y de defensa en lugar de teléfonos de consumo
Cumplimiento normativo Amplia experiencia con requisitos aeroespaciales (EN 9100), médicos (ISO 13485), automotrices (IATF 16949) y de seguridad en defensa
Proximidad europea Tiempos de entrega más cortos, comunicación más sencilla, misma zona horaria y logística de la UE más simple para clientes europeos
Protección de la propiedad intelectual Los marcos legales franceses y de la UE ofrecen una fuerte protección de PI — importante para diseños de defensa y médicos
Profundidad en ingeniería Fuertes capacidades de diseño para fabricación y pruebas, a menudo incluyendo centros de I+D internos
Clústeres automotrices e industriales Proximidad a OEMs automotrices franceses, principales aeroespaciales (Airbus, Dassault) y fabricantes ferroviarios (Alstom)

Francia es también la cuna de la cadena de suministro de electrónica aeroespacial más experimentada del mundo — un legado que se refleja en los sistemas de gestión de calidad y la disciplina documental de sus proveedores de servicios de fabricación electrónica.

Asteelflash Group — EMS #2 de Europa

Sede: Neuilly-Plaisance, Francia  |  Fundada: 1999  |  Empleados: ~5,700  |  Ingresos: €1,048 millones (2018)

Asteelflash destaca como la segunda organización EMS más grande de Europa que compite por un lugar entre las 20 principales empresas EMS a nivel mundial. Cuenta con 18 sitios de fabricación en ubicaciones como Europa, Asia, Norteamérica y África y posee plantas en Francia, Alemania, Túnez, China, EE. UU. y México que cubren un área de aproximadamente dos millones de pies cuadrados. Asteelflash fue adquirida por USI (Universal Scientific Industrial), una de las mayores empresas EMS situadas en Shanghái y Taiwán, en 2020 y se convirtió en parte de un gigante del sector que proporciona acceso a una capacidad tremenda en Asia.

Direcciones de mercado (aprox. participación de ingresos): Industrial 30%, Procesamiento de datos 28%, Gestión energética 18%, Transporte 15%, Médico 5%, Defensa y espacio 4%.

Razones para elegir Asteelflash: Realiza todo con alta complejidad y alta variedad como tecnologías de redes inteligentes, sistemas de automatización, electrónica de defensa, dispositivos médicos portátiles, etc.

Lacroix Electronics — El especialista en IoT industrial

Sede: Saint-Herblain, Francia  |  Fundada: 1936  |  Fábricas: Francia, Alemania, Polonia, Túnez

Lacroix Group es una empresa de electrónica e Internet de las Cosas con sede en Francia, donde Lacroix Electronics es su división EMS. Lacroix Electronics es reconocida como una de las mejores fabricantes por contrato en el mundo. La empresa ofrece servicios de diseño electrónico y ensamblaje para clientes en los mercados automotriz, industrial, domótica, medicina, aviónica civil y defensa, contando con cinco oficinas para operaciones de diseño ubicadas en Francia y Alemania.

Razones para elegir Lacroix Group: La empresa es bien conocida por sus productos de conectividad y su experiencia en fabricación inalámbrica, y se especializa en artículos como medidores inteligentes y productos industriales inalámbricos. También proporciona un proceso completo de servicios de fabricación, desde el diseño hasta la reparación.

ALL Circuits — Enfoque Automotriz e Industrial

Sede: Meung-sur-Loire, Francia  |  Fundada: 2009  |  Especialidad: Electrónica automotriz e industrial

La empresa francesa ALL Circuits se especializa en ofrecer EMS (servicios de fabricación electrónica) con un enfoque en los mercados automotriz e industrial. La empresa ofrece servicios en diseño, industrialización, producción y logística para cada etapa del ciclo de vida del producto y se especializa en la fabricación de PCBA (ensamblaje de placas de circuito impreso) de alta calidad en volúmenes moderados a altos.

Por qué los compradores la prefieren: Si busca un proveedor de servicios de fabricación electrónica con especialización en electrónica automotriz (como ECUs, sensores y sistemas de control de iluminación), o industrial:

Eolane — Especialización en Defensa, Ferrocarril y Medicina

Headquarters: Rhône-Alpes, France  |  Founded: 1975  |  Footprint: Production on three continents

Eolane is an EMS provider, design, and manufacturer of electronic assemblies engaged in eight principal markets: defense, industrial, telecom, railway, automotive, medical, energy, and aerospace. Eolane has built remarkable ODM (Original Design Manufacturer) and CDM (Contract Design Manufacturer) know-how producing PCBAs in small to large amounts, resulting in the integration of PCBAs into finished products.

Reasons for selection by customers: Eolane is one of the most diversified French EMS companies, with real design capabilities, which is important when engineering help is required for the product beyond the mere assembly of the product. Its railway and defense certifications add more to the company’s reputation as a reliable partner for sensitive projects.

5. Cofidur EMS — Aerospace & Defense Heritage

Headquarters: Laval, France  |  Founded: 1968  |  Specialty: Aviation, defense, medical, telecom, transportation

Cofidur EMS is among the oldest electronic subcontractors in France, operating in the aviation, defense, medical, telecom, transport, and lighting sectors. Its services comprise supply chain, card production, industrial manufacturing, testing, project management, refurbishing, rebuilding, and prototyping.

Key points that make it attractive to customers: Cofidur’s long track record of 50 years and half a century of certification (EN 9100-class) make it the desired partner for procurement teams engaged in aerospace and defense electronics, where the criteria of documentation, traceability, and quality are mandatory.

6. ICAPE Group — PCB Sourcing Powerhouse

Headquarters: Fontenay-aux-Roses, Paris  |  Founded: 1999  |  Team: ~320 people worldwide

The ICAPE Group does not resemble a traditional EMS provider in that it is a PCB and component sourcing specialist who collaborates with more than 75 manufacturers based in Asia (25 PCB manufacturers, and 50 component manufacturers) to produce PCBs and components in large volumes. The Group serves as a link between Europe’s engineering and Asia’s production capabilities.

What makes it an attractive partner for customers: In case you wish to get PCBs and components from Asia at a low price and yet wish to receive control over the quality of production, communicate with the seller in French, and work locally with an engineer, ICAPE could be a good substitute for working with a real EMS provider.

How to Choose the Right EMS Partner

How to Choose the Right EMS Partner

A hardware company’s decision about the selection of its EMS provider is one of the most essential topics for discussion in its supply chain management. Below is a two-step process to follow during the choice of an EMS provider:

  • Clearly define the product profile. Analyze the annual production volume, number of types of goods (whether they are high-mix or low-mix), technical difficulty of the products (number of layers, technology), and testing requirements related to the products. For example, Asteelflash and other high-mix companies are too high-profile and highly-priced for the production of easy single mixed boards, while some Asian low-mix manufacturers are not able to produce complicated medical devices.
  • Check if the certifications correspond to the product’s needs. Some medical equipment may require ISO 13485 certification, aerospace technologies should be certified according to EN 9100 standard, and automotive manufacturing requires the products to meet the IATF 16949 standard. It is important to obtain relevant documents instead of taking the company’s word for it.
  • Determine the buying power of the EMS providers. Nowadays, having ability to buy the components is more important than producing at a low price, therefore knowing about the availability of the preferred suppliers and the systems of management of obsolescence is essential.
  • Request DfM information in advance. A good EMS conducts a design review, which allows estimating whether the manufacturer is mature enough to start producing.
  • Conduct factory audit. It is obligatory to perform onsite audits in industries such as weapon building, medicine, and automobile manufacturing.
  • Compare total landed cost instead of just looking at unit prices. Consider costs connected with tooling/NRE, test fixtures, freight, duties, safety stock, and yield, rather than looking at the price only. What Does EMS Cost?

EMS pricing is heavily project-specific, but these 2025-2026 benchmarks give a realistic sense of the market:

Service / Scenario Typical Cost Range
PCB assembly setup / NRE (tooling, programming) $500 – $10,000 depending on complexity
Simple 2-layer board assembly (per board, at 1k-10k volume) $1 – $8
Complex 8-12 layer board assembly (per board, low volume) $20 – $150+
Box build assembly (per unit, medium volume) $5 – $80+ depending on mechanical complexity
ICT / functional test fixture development $3,000 – $30,000
Component sourcing fee (percentage of BOM) Typically 5-15% of component cost
Full product launch program (design to mass production) $50,000 – $500,000+

French EMS providers typically charge about 30-60% more for assembly costs than Asian high-volume factories; however, French EMS providers win through faster delivery time (days instead of weeks to deliver to the EU), strong compliance, design engineering assistance, and reduced risk of regulatory issues.

What is the difference between EMS and ODM?

The EMS firms create products designed by clients themselves by manufacturing, testing, and shipping them. On the other hand, ODM firms produce items based on their own technology. They may even sell these goods as a client-own product. Quite a few firms find both of them useful. Companies like Eolane and Lacroix are examples of French companies providing both options to their clients.

Which country has the largest EMS industry?

China and Taiwan produce the greatest quantity of EMS products, with global dominance going to Foxconn (Taiwan/China), Pegatron, Quanta, and USI. In Europe, the largest companies include Asteelflash (France), Zollner (Germany), and Nedap/Kitron (Northern Europe). France boasts one of the top EMS markets in Europe for complex and regulated electronics.

How much does it cost to start EMS production?

Budget an amount that ranges from $5,000-$50,000 for the first non-recurring engineering (NRE) and implementation of an average circuit board. This should include assembly programming, test equipment, tooling, and first article approval that precedes the costs of the manufactured products. A simple circuit board can be produced for less than $10,000 while an advanced regulated product can costs up to $100,000 for engineering and qualification.

How do I know if I need an EMS partner?

You probably require the services of an EMS partner if your internal team is spending all its time manufacturing instead of designing products, if your production volume has surpassed the capabilities of hand-assembly shops, if you require specialized certifications (such as ISO 13485, EN 9100), or if obtaining components is taking up too much time for your engineers. When production is at around 500 boards per year or less, and there is no need for certifications, working with a PCB assembly prototype shop tends to be less expensive than forming a partnership with an EMS provider.

Conclusión

Although the electronic manufacturing services industry of France is not large in size as compared to that of Asia, its offerings are worth it: they are flexible concerning production and meet high quality requirements compatible with those used in the aerospace area, and at the same time are very close to the market, have well-developed IP protection mechanisms, and boast very good engineering design skills – the ones many Asian companies do not have. The key player in the electronic manufacturing industry in Europe is Asteelflash.

When it comes to choosing the right EMS company, it is necessary to take into account the characteristics of your product, e.g., if your product is sensitive, it is better to select a French or EU EMS company; in case your goal is to get the lowest price, Asian EMS providers would suit you best. The most favorable solution includes a combination of the two – using a European company for prototyping and an Asian company for mass production. Whatever option you choose, you always need to define the specifics of your project, check the certificates and compare the prices for manufacturing in different countries.
